Top 10 Things You Don’t Bill For, But Should!

10 Consultation calls.

9 Contract prep.

8 Thinking up & writing proposals.

7 Travel costs (mileage, parking...even time!)

6 Mailing, faxing, copying fees.

5 “It’s perfect! Just one more thing...”

4 PayPal fees (or any other fees you incur when they pay your invoices).

3 Time spent answering “little” emails and brief phone calls.

2 Sales tax, if your state/province charges it.

1 The time spent having those brilliant ideas in the shower.

The Bottom Line

We've said it before & we'll say it again: Undercharging is a freelancer's disease. Sadly, it's infectious!

We don't just mean charging an hourly rate that's too low, but not charging for your expenses, and not charging for all your time that you use up to serve your client.

Would you feel weird itemizing these on your invoice? Well, that's okay. You don't have to. If you're uncomfortable with saying outright that you're charging for "toilet brainstorming," you're not alone. But you should bill for the time, call it what you like! And the other things, like contract prep or copying fees, you can work into your new, increased hourly rate. Your job is to ensure they're covered, one way or another.

Undercharging hurts everyone. Charging for your time, and your expenses, results in a healthier, happier, more relaxed you... and that means better work for your clients.
